海洋氧含量是衡量海洋生态系统健康状况的重要指标之一。通过对海洋氧含量的可视化分析,可以更好地了解海洋环境的变化和生物活动的分布。在这方面,Matlab是一种功能强大的工具,它提供了丰富的函数和工具箱,用于处理和可视化地理数据。下面介绍几种用Matlab实现海洋氧含量分布可视化分析的方法。
& {1 |! v* C/ Q. O- H+ S9 w! \1 _4 l8 K! ?; y% v
首先,可以使用Matlab中的地图绘制函数来创建海洋氧含量的空间分布图。可以使用基于经纬度坐标的地图投影,例如Mercator投影或极射投影,以便更好地显示全球范围内的分布情况。将海洋氧含量数据与地图投影结合,可以直观地展示不同地区的氧含量差异。$ p8 G1 [5 `" _2 i- @
$ ^3 r4 L3 ]4 h7 u8 l8 f2 v其次,Matlab提供了丰富的数据处理和统计函数,可以对海洋氧含量数据进行分析。可以使用这些函数计算平均氧含量、氧含量标准差等统计指标,并将结果可视化为柱状图、箱线图等形式,以便比较不同地区或时间点的氧含量差异。$ m- J5 q( q; y9 _: T$ B
- i6 U, \: i8 W, Y另外,Matlab还支持插值函数,可以通过插值方法填补氧含量数据的空白或缺失值。通过这种方法,可以更准确地估计全球范围内的海洋氧含量分布,并在地图上进行可视化展示。* x, m" v; A3 `' w) V: L3 n
8 ]; J- b6 l/ j1 h# g A
此外,Matlab还提供了强大的数据可视化函数,可以绘制等值线图、热力图、颜色图等不同类型的图表,用于展示海洋氧含量的空间分布。通过调整图表的颜色映射、等值线间距等参数,可以更好地突出氧含量差异的模式和趋势。" n# v* t0 \7 N# T9 P& O
! q6 D; T) `. j$ J# w
除了空间分布,时间分布也是海洋氧含量研究的重要方面。Matlab提供了时序数据处理和可视化的函数,可以对海洋氧含量数据进行时间序列分析。可以使用这些函数计算滑动平均、相关系数等指标,以及绘制时间序列图、频谱图等形式,来分析海洋氧含量的季节性变化和长期趋势。
) y+ G7 q9 ^% C" }5 w) U. S; ^3 a6 x. i! X9 M2 e. h5 g
总之,利用Matlab的地理图功能,结合其丰富的数据处理和可视化函数,可以实现海洋氧含量分布的可视化分析。通过这些方法,我们可以更好地理解海洋环境中的氧含量变化,并为海洋生态系统的保护和管理提供科学依据。 |